SOCCER SHOTS NASHVILLE:
Soccer Shots Nashville stretches from Wilson Sumner Robertson and Rutherford Counties to Williamson and Southern Davidson Counties. Offices are located in Nashville TN. Soccer Shots Nashville is supported by Soccer Shots DC/MD/VA headquartered in Laurel MD including but not limited to human resources operations payroll and professional development. Soccer Shots Nashville offers programs at nearly 100 locations serves over 1800 participants and employs approximately 25 part-time coaches.
REPORTS TO: Program Director

Academic and Experiential Objectives:
The intern will be required to handle and present him/herself in a professional manner consistently arriving on time to assigned office hours coaching sessions and events. S/he will be expected to assist in the overall execution of a Soccer Shots season and will gain knowledge in the planning scheduling sales/marketing customer service and management side of the business. Throughout the season the intern will have the opportunity to organize and coordinate an annual clinic which is an important aspect of Soccer Shots community outreach. The student intern will also participate in instructing Soccer Shots sessions giving him/her experience in coaching youth and working with parents.

Internship Structure and Compensation:
The Soccer Shots internship will encompass a minimum of 240 hours over a 12-week period . The internship will include twelve consecutive 20-hour (minimum) work weeks for the duration of the internship. During the first four weeks of the internship the intern will be working closely with the Program Director on preparing for the upcoming season -- scheduling instructors running demos and promoting the season. Once the season starts the student interns schedule will be half in the office working on various tasks projects & assignments and half coaching at various locations and programs


Requirements
  • Prior soccer experience is not required. We only require the passion for positively impacting childrens lives through the love of sports and fitness.
  • Valid drivers license and access to personal vehicle
  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• At least one consistent Weekday Evening (4pm-7pm) & one weekend morning (8am-12pm) available per week
Compensation: $12.50 per hour
